Brown Bear Brown Bear

October 24 - 25 at 11 am

Brown Bear, Brown Bear, What Do You See? is a classic children's book by Bill Martin Jr. with illustrations by Eric Carle, featuring a repetitive, rhythmic text and bold, colorful collage art that introduces colors and animals like a brown bear, red bird, yellow duck, and blue horse.

Velveteen Rabbit

March 20 - 21 at 11 am

The Velveteen Rabbit is a classic 1922 children's book by Margery Williams and illustrated by William Nicholson. It tells the heartwarming story of a stuffed rabbit who longs to become "Real" through the unconditional love of his owner, exploring deep themes of love, loss, and the nature of existence.

Winnie the Pooh

June 12 - 13 at 11 am

Published on October 14, 1926, Winnie-the-Pooh is a classic children's book by English author A. A. Milne, beautifully illustrated by E. H. Shepard. It follows the gentle adventures of an anthropomorphic teddy bear and his friends in the Hundred Acre Wood.
